De Havilland DH-82 CFFDZ
28 September 1980 · San Rafael, California, United States · Minor injuries
Summary
On 28 September 1980 at about 14:20 local time, a De Havilland DH-82 registered CFFDZ was involved in an accident during the landing phase of flight near San Rafael, California, United States. 2 people were on board and one had minor injuries. The aircraft was substantially damaged. No probable cause statement is available for this record.

Read the full NTSB narrative
L WING DROPPED, HIT LEVEE WHEN PLT ADDED PWR.WND GSTG 10KTS.
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record.
